Fire opens SuperLiga tourney against San Luis
The Fire, in the midst of a three-game losing streak, opens the SuperLiga tournament at 7 p.m. Saturday when it takes on Mexican team San Luis at Toyota Park.

Morning Ticker: Blanco leads Fire to SuperLiga final, Estudiantes wins Copa and more
soccerbyives.net 7/16/2009 — The Chicago Fire moved one step closer to silverware on Wednesday night, riding a Cuauhtemoc Blanco free kick to knock off the New England Revolution, 2-1, in the SuperLiga semifinals.
